| Abstract | Mobile robotics is a research area that has witnessed incredible advances for the last decades. Within this well-studied domain of mobile robotics, our area of interest is robots that inhabit in unmodified office-like environments that are designed for and shared with people. Issues like mapping, self-localization, and autonomous navigation in an indoor environment are popular issues in the field of autonomous robots and have been deeply studied for the past few years. The presented work describes how a Robot Operating System ROS-based control system is used with a mobile robot for selflocalization, indoor mapping and autonomous navigation in an office like environment. |
